Given

Ratio of vitamin A in cow milk to goat milk = 3 : 4

Required

Determine the content of vitamin A in goat milk if cow milk has 1560 IU

The given parameters shows a direct proportion.

Let G represents Goat and C represent Cow

Given that there exists a direct proportion;

C = K * G where K represents the constant of proportionality.

Solving for K when C = 3 and G = 4

C = K * G becomes

3 = K * 4

3 = 4K

Divide through by 4

¾ = K

K = ¾

Now, solving for G given that C = 1560IU;

We'll make use of the same formula as above

C = K * G

Substitute 1560 for C and ¾ for K; the expression becomes

1560 = ¾ * G

Multiply both sides by 4

4 * 1560 = 4 * ¾ * G

6240 = 3 * G

Multiply both sides by ⅓

⅓ * 6240 = ⅓ * 3 * G

2080 = G

G = 2080

Hence, the vitamin A in the goat milk is 2080IU

How, if at all, does religion affect health and social welfare? Under what, if any, conditions does religion help to improve the lives of disadvantaged urban children and families, and how, if at all, can we foster those conditions? Is there any significant body of evidence to suggest that religion reduces crime and delinquency among low-income, inner-city youth?

In 1995, when I began asking these questions in earnest, there was little reliable empirical research with which to address them. Today, however, we have many first-rate statistical and ethnographic studies that supply some preliminary answers. Though far from definitive, the evidence to date suggests that religion can improve individual well-being and ameliorate specific social problems.

But what types of religious influences are most beneficial to the individual and society? At least three separate but related faith factors can be identified-what I will call “organic religion,” “programmatic religion,” and “ecological religion.” “Organic religion” is defined as a belief in God and regular attendance of religious services in a church, synagogue, mosque, or other traditional places of worship. “Programmatic religion” refers to individual participation in social programs run by organizations with a religious affiliation. With or without attending religious services, a child might be enrolled in an after-school program that is staffed mainly by religious leaders and volunteers. Lastly, even if one does not believe in God or attend services or religiously run social programs, one may still be exposed to “ecological religion.” For many urban youths, the only institutions more ubiquitous than liquor outlets are churches, the only unbroken windows they see are stainedglass windows, and many of the social-service programs that routinely supply them or their neighbors with basic necessities and services are operated through community ministries. Even without any formal religion in their lives, such youths may still be exposed to religious influences.

State of the research

The empirical research to date suggests that, especially for low-income urban children, youth, and young adults, these different forms of religious influence help to counter other, negative individual and social influences. Other things being equal, church attendance, participation in faith-based programs, and benefits received or services delivered from the hands of people working through local congregations are each associated with a greater probability that urban youth will escape poverty, crime, and other social ills.
